Safety
Kids bunk beds with stairways offer safer alternatives to ladders. Ladders are dangerous and can cause kids to fall or get caught up while climbing up or down the bed. Stairs provide a stable, wide route to the top bunk which eliminates the risk. The top bunk can be stepped down by the child without the need for assistance from their parents. This lowers the risk of accidents.
If you're thinking of buying a bunk bed with stairs for your kids be sure it is in compliance with all relevant safety standards and certifications. This will make sure that the bed is certified and has been approved by a third party organization to comply with all the national and local child safety regulations.
Some manufacturers place age limits regarding the use of their bunk beds, typically for children younger than six. This is due to the fact that very young children may not be able to climb up and down a ladder safely, and they could end up falling out of the bed, which can be extremely risky. It is also recommended that only one child sleeps on the top bunk at any one time, to minimise the risk of injury due to rough play or jumping.
When you are looking for a children' bunk bed with stairs, select one that has guardrails on each side of the bed. The space between them should be no more than 3 1/2 inches in width. This will stop a child from falling under the railing and getting trapped between the mattress foundation. Take away any tripping hazards like backpacks, clothing, and toys from the area surrounding the ladder. Encourage your children to clean their sleeping space prior to going to bed.
Keep bunk beds away from ceiling fans, windows and other items that could fall onto the child. It's also an excellent idea to place a night light in the room, so that your children can see where they are going if they need to get up in the middle of the night or come down from the top bunk during the time of a sleepover.
